
Windscale opened their Monkwearmouth Cup campaign with a comfortable 6-2 win at Division One side Ferryhill Athletic.
On a difficult Dean Bank surface against a committed and physical side, the Atoms grasped the initiative early with goals from Owen Bell, Ross Leeson, Matty Pierce and Lewis Selkirk producing a healthy 4-0 half-time cushion.
Ferryhill indicated their intentions following the restart and were back in the game at 4-2 with strikes from Adam Morland and Kieron Richardson.
The introduction of Kieron Fraser for the Atoms turned the contest back into their favour, making his presence felt with two well-taken goals.
These completed the scoring and ensured Windscale’s passage into the next round.
The Atoms begin their Fred Conway Cumberland Senior Cup journey with a mid-week game on Wednesday under the lights at the Falcon Ground.
They have been drawn against Westmorland League side Braithwaite with a 7pm kick-off.
Cup Competitors continue on the agenda next Saturday. They host Darlington Town in the Alan Hood Memorial Trophy. It’s a repeat of last year’s final which saw Darlington claim the trophy with a victory against the Atoms on penalties.
